H2. What is Lipitor?
Lipitor, also known as atorvastatin, is a statin medication that belongs to the HMG-CoA reductase inhibitor class. It works by blocking the production of cholesterol in the liver, thereby reducing the levels of low-density lipoprotein (LDL) or "bad" cholesterol in the blood. Lipitor has been widely prescribed to treat high cholesterol and reduce the risk of cardiovascular disease.

H8. Side Effects of Lipitor
Like all medications, Lipitor can cause side effects, including muscle pain, liver damage, and increased blood sugar levels. It is essential to discuss the potential side effects of Lipitor with your healthcare provider before starting treatment.
